## Formula sandbox tuning

User-supplied formulas in Gridmoor execute inside a restricted interpreter with hard ceilings on time, memory, and call depth. Reviewers should confirm any change to these ceilings is justified in the PR description, since raising them widens the abuse surface. Defaults were chosen from production traces. The current limits are as follows.

limits module of tafog-fawip:
WEIGHTS = {
    "julix": 57,
    "lamys": 992,
    "kasvan": 209,
    "quenok": 750,
    "alddor": 259,
    "oliath": 1009,
    "wenix": 815,
}

// MAX_EXIF_PASSES controls how many scrub iterations the Pellwick
// pipeline runs per upload. Two passes catch nested thumbnails that
// survive the first strip; three is wasteful at our volume. If GPS
// tags reappear in spot checks, bump this before paging the Orvane
// imaging team. The build this default was validated against is noted below.

session token of hawif-bajog = htk6_9ab8da

Heads up, on-call: the signing vault for Updrift's device-firmware update channel locked itself after three failed auth attempts from the stale CI runner (classic). No firmware builds can be promoted to the stable channel until it's unsealed, and Lindqvist's hardware team is waiting on the 4.1 rollout. Kill the stale runner first so it doesn't re-lock things, then run the vault unseal flow from the ops jumpbox. It will prompt for the recovery passphrase listed below.

unlock words, hahip-baduf: holwyn-istath-julvan